When the taxman tethers TDS to a time machine TDS or tax deducted at source has been a bone of contention between the taxpayers and the taxman for sometime now. Failure to comply with TDS provisions results in possible disallowance of expense in the hands of the payer (or entity), besides interest and penal consequences. Naturally, most people believe in the old saying - TDS is very tedious, comments Mr Arvind Singhal, a Delhi-based chartered accountant.
